Job description

ESF is now recruiting for a Senior Procurement Officer.

The Senior Procurement Officer (Works & Facilities) will assist the Procurement Manager (Works & Facilities) oversee and manage all procurement activities related to campus development, major and minor works, asset enhancement, and facilities management. This role requires a strong engineering or project management background to ensure that all capital projects, maintenance contracts, and facilities-related sourcing are executed transparently, cost-effectively, and in strict compliance with local building ordinances and statutory requirements.

Key Responsibilities
  • Contribute end-to-end procurement cycles for major capital works, campus renovations, facilities management (FM) contracts, and structural maintenance.
  • Identify the potential contractors, prepare tender document/RFP/RFQ, invite tenders/quotations, conduct technical and commercial evaluations of bids, collaborating closely with internal users and facilities team.
  • Monitor and evaluate supplier performance and implement corrective actions when necessary.
  • Develop and maintain strong, long-term relationships with a robust network of contractors, consultants, and suppliers.
  • Oversee day-to-day purchasing operations, ensuring all transactions comply with corporate governance, internal procurement policies, and ethical standards.
  • Utilize E-tendering systems and e-procurement tools to streamline workflows, track purchase orders, and manage inventory levels.
  • Analyze market trends, material price fluctuations, and supply chain risks to provide actionable insights to the Procurement Manager.
Education & Experience
  • Degree: Bachelor’s Degree in Building Management, Engineering (Mechanical, Electrical, Civil), Supply Chain Management, or a related technical discipline.
  • Experience: A minimum of 3 to 5 years of relevant procurement experience, specifically gained within sizeable organizations (e.g., property developers, main contractors, MNCs, or large-scale facility management firms).
  • Certification: Professional qualification from recognized bodies (e.g., CIPS, ISM) is highly advantageous.
Technical Knowledge & Skills
  • Familiarity with the Building Ordinance and relevant statutory/regulatory frameworks governing building works and facility maintenance.
  • Expertise in tendering procedures and building contract or local standard forms of building contracts.
Language & Communication
  • Fluency in English (spoken and written) is mandatory. The candidate must be comfortable negotiating, presenting, and drafting documents in English.
  • Good interpersonal and presentation skills.
Personal Attributes
  • Outgoing and proactive personality: A natural relationship-builder who enjoys engaging with diverse stakeholders.

About Us

The English Schools Foundation (ESF) is the largest English-medium international school organisation in Hong Kong. Our 22 schools and comprehensive programme of extra-curricular activities bring out the best in every student through a personalised approach to learning and by inspiring curious minds.

www.esf.edu.hk

About The Team

The English Schools Foundation (ESF) is a modern, well-managed educational organisation, committed to offering an international education to students drawn from over 70 countries. We are proud to be at the forefront of the educational hub in Hong Kong. We actively take advantage of the opportunities that Hong Kong offers as Asia’s world city and the principal gate-way to China. The curriculum, leading to the International Baccalaureate, is adapted to Hong Kong, and the Asia Pacific region. ESF’s 1,100 teachers are highly qualified bringing with them experience from Australia, Canada, New Zealand, the United States, the UK and many other international school systems. All schools offer a broad range of out-of-school activities in Hong Kong and overseas. ESF has over 18,000 students. Our culture is one of joy in learning and pride in achievement. The great majority of our students study for the IB Diploma and gain entry to universities all over the world. ESF has a long-standing commitment to children with individual needs and is the principal provider for English-speaking children with special educational needs in Hong Kong.
